General Info

In Block

e593efa9965a006ea41b6611269fd9fb6ee2a3b2e1ab416b3fbcc2d1313b0436

In block height

5100095

Total Input

2643.42980626 DOGE

Total Output

2643.38348626 DOGE

Transaction Details